Detailsinfo

A vulnerability was found in Apple Mac OS X 10.5.4 (Operating System). It has been declared as critical. Affected by this vulnerability is an unknown functionality of the component Data Detectors.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a resource management v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-399. As an impact it is known to affect availability. The summary by CVE is:

Unspecified vulnerability in Data Detectors Engine in Apple Mac OS X 10.5.4 allows attackers to cause a denial of service (resource consumption) via crafted textual content in messages.

The bug was discovered 08/01/2008. The weakness was presented 08/03/2008 by Michal Zalewski (Shadow) (Website). The advisory is shared at securityfocus.com. This vulnerability is known as CVE-2008-2323 since 05/18/2008. The attack can be launched remotely. The exploitation doesn't need any form of authentication. Neither technical details nor an exploit are publicly available.

It is declared as proof-of-concept. The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 33790 (Mac OS X Multiple Vulnerabilities (Security Update 2008-005)),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ment. It is assigned to the family MacOS X Local Security Checks and running in the context l. The commercial vulnerability scanner Qualys is able to test this issue with plugin 115872 (Apple Security Update 2008-005 Not Installed).

Upgrading eliminates this vulnerability. A possible mitigation has been published even before and not after the disclosure of the vulnerability.

The vulnerability is also documented in the databases at X-Force (44130), Tenable (33790), SecurityFocus (BID 30483†), OSVDB (48566†) and Secunia (SA31326†).
